NJ27SE 8005 unlocated
NLO: Lossiemouth [name: NJ 235 705].
Possibly within Maritime - Highland.
(Classified as barque, with cargo of bricks and cordage: date of loss cited as 24 March 1812). Anne: this vessel foundered off Lossiemouth. (Built: 1802?)
Registration: Nairn. 87 tons burthern.
(Location of loss cited as N57 45.00 W3 15.00).
I G Whittaker 1998.
The map sheet and quasi-administrative area assigned to this record are essentially arbitrary, being derived from the unverified location of loss that is cited by Whittaker. The loss of this vessel may have occurred within the area designated Maritime - Highland.
Information from RCAHMS (RJCM), 25 February 2011.
